Output 17112a5b9fefb72627b3170176cfa3987136b116ae7ee818a90d5a6a79fe9e26:0

value
199920314
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ff57044e9b631c856f6b025aff148ab15db54cb9 OP_EQUAL
address
3Qy8UVh1KRWL3iy4yBmakuj76iyWA8d65g
transaction
17112a5b9fefb72627b3170176cfa3987136b116ae7ee818a90d5a6a79fe9e26
confirmations
405376
spent
true